#144854 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#144854 is composed of 7.8% red, 28.2%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.2% cyan, 14.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 191.3 degrees, a saturation of 61.5% and a lightness of 20.4%. #144854 color hex could be obtained by blending #2890a8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

● #144854 color description : Very dark cyan.
#144854 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#144854 has RGB values of R:20, G:72,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.14,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 1329236.

Shades and Tints of #144854
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010405 is the darkest color, while #f4fb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#144854
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#303738 is the less saturated color, while #005568 is the most saturated one.
